Join us and discover how we build community one meal at a time.Job SummaryWe are seeking a full-time Nutrition Care Manager (Certified Dietary Manager or Dietetic Technician) to join our Nutrition Team in a senior living community in Oklahoma City, OK-$2500 Sign on BonusKey Responsibilities:
- Provides nutritional screening, monitoring, and implementation of the nutrition plan of care for the residents under the guidance of the Registered Dietitian
- Advises the dining department on resident care and meal service matters as well as conducts meal rounds per company protocols
- Assists with the planning of menus regarding nutrition, regulatory compliance, general resident population preferences, and wellness trends/initiatives
- Provides full cycle supervision and training of the dining service team
- Complies with all regulatory agency standards, including federal, state, and accrediting agencies while adhering to community confidentiality, HIPAA regulations, and resident rights policies
- Participates in/ Leads resident satisfaction programs, departmental meetings, and facility wide Quality Assurance/Performance Improvement Programs
- Associate or bachelor’s degree in nutrition & dietetics, or related field, required
- Credentialed as a Certified Dietary Manager (CDM) or Dietetic Technician, registered (DTR), preferred
- One year of senior living experience, preferred
- Supervisory experience, desirable
- ServSafe® certified, desirable
- Possess the necessary skills to effectively utilize Microsoft office applications, electronic medical record & diet office systems, and nutrient analysis programming
